We have a lime tree in 15 gallon pot and other in 3″ pots, and the leaves have a glossy film on them which is curling the leaves. What is the cure? I know you know the cause.

This is a sign of a pest infestation. The glossy film is honeydew. Check the undersides of leaves and where the stems meet. There are several that it could be and, fortunately, they are all treated the same way.

Treat the plant with a pesticide. I personally like neem oil, as it is safe for people and pets. Here is more info on it: https://www.gardeningknowhow.com/plant-problems/pests/pesticides/neem-oil-uses.htm
